What’s in Chicken Florentine
This creamy chicken dinner features budget-friendly ingredients that you might already have on hand!
- Chicken Thighs: Boneless chicken thighs are preferred.
- Garlic Cloves: Use fresh garlic for the best flavor, not pre-minced.
- Olive Oil: I recommend using a good quality extra virgin olive oil.
- Seasonings: You’ll need a medley of paprika, black pepper, salt, and turmeric.
- White Wine: Learn all about the best wines to cook with HERE!
- Heavy Cream: For the creamiest sauce, I don’t recommend using any other dairy product.
- Spinach: Use fresh spinach, not canned or frozen.
- Parmesan: Use freshly grated parmesan cheese for the best flavor and consistency.
- Green Onions: The BEST garnish for chicken florentine!
PRO TIP: If you want to omit the wine, you can substitute it with chicken broth.
What else can I add?
Feel free to add some mushrooms if you’d like! You can also sprinkle in some Italian seasoning for a more herbaceous flavor.

How to Store and Reheat
Once cooled to room temperature, you can store any leftovers you have in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in the microwave in 30 second intervals until warmed through.
Serving Suggestions
I like to serve chicken florentine over pasta so none of that delicious sauce goes to waste! Rice works well for the same reason.

Ingredients
- 3-4 boneless chicken thighs
- 2 garlic cloves crushed
- ¼ cup extra virgin olive oil
- 2 teaspoons sweet paprika
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on turmeric
- ¼ cup white wine
- 2 cups heavy cream
- 3 cups fresh spinach leaves
- ⅓ parmesan cheese grated
- 1 fresh onion stalk
Instructions
- Create a marinade of extra virgin olive oil, garlic, black pepper, salt, turmeric, and sweet paprika. Place marinade in a ziplock bag.2 garlic cloves, ¼ cup extra virgin olive oil, ½ teaspoon black pepper, ½ teaspoon salt, ½ teaspoon turmeric, 2 teaspoons sweet paprika
- Add chicken thighs to ziplock bag with marinade, shake to coat, and place it in the fridge. Let the chicken marinate for two hours.3-4 boneless chicken thighs
- Cook marinated chicken in a non-stick pan over medium-hight heat, for 8-10 minutes on each side. Set aside.
- Deglaze pan with wine, scraping bits of chicken off the surface of the pan with a wooden utensil.¼ cup white wine
- Add spinach and heavy cream to pan, and cook for five minutes on medium heat.2 cups heavy cream, 3 cups fresh spinach leaves
- Add parmesan and cook for an additional two minutes.⅓ parmesan cheese
- Place chicken back in the pan and let it cook for an additional two minutes.
- Chop fresh onion and sprinkle over chicken.1 fresh onion stalk
- Serve hot and enjoy!
